Abstract
A method and apparatus for minimizing engine weight for a turbine engine by utilizing one or more discrete protuberances disposed on an engine component wall. The wall can have a nominal thickness to decrease engine weight while the protuberances can provide increased discrete thicknesses for providing one or more cooling holes. The increased thickness at the protuberances provides for an increased thickness to provide sufficient length to increase cooling hole effectiveness.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A component for a turbine engine, with the turbine engine generating a hot combustion gas flow and providing a cooling fluid flow, the component comprising:
a wall having a nominal thickness separating the hot combustion gas flow from the cooling fluid flow having a hot surface facing the hot combustion gas flow and a cool surface facing the cooling fluid flow; at least one localized, protuberance extending from the cool surface; and a film hole extending through the protuberance and the wall, having a length greater than the nominal thickness of the wall.
2 . The component of claim 1 wherein the film hole is angled relative to a local normal between the hot surface and the cool surface.
3 . The component of claim 1 wherein the film hole is non-linear.
4 . The component of claim 1 wherein the film hole includes an inlet and an outlet, having a passage connecting the inlet to the outlet.
5 . The component of claim 4 wherein at least one of the inlet, outlet, or passage is shaped.
6 . The component of claim 4 wherein the protuberance includes an upstream side and a downstream side having the inlet disposed on the upstream side.
7 . The component of claim 1 wherein the protuberance includes a height and the height is at least 50% of the nominal thickness.
8 . The component of claim 7 wherein the height is at least 100% of the nominal thickness.
9 . The component of claim 1 wherein the protuberance is symmetrical about an axis parallel to a direction of the cooling fluid flow within the component.
10 . The component of claim 1 wherein the protuberance includes a height and the height is a function of one of a length, diameter, or length-to-diameter ratio of the film hole.
11 . The component of claim 1 wherein the protuberance includes an upstream side and a downstream side having the film hole disposed on the upstream side.
12 . The component of claim 1 wherein the at least one protuberance includes a recess.
13 . The component of claim 12 wherein the film hole is disposed in the recess.
14 . The component of claim 1 wherein the nominal thickness is a function of at least one of a thermal load, vibratory force, pressure differential between the fluid flows, or manufacturer required load for the component.
15 . The component of claim 1 wherein the protuberances are formed by additive manufacturing.
16 . The component of claim 1 wherein the protuberance is one of rounded, conical, frustoconical, or non-rectilinear.
17 . The component of claim 1 wherein there is one film hole disposed in the at least one protuberance.
18 . An airfoil for a turbine engine comprising:
a wall having a first side adjacent to a first fluid flow and a second side adjacent to a second fluid flow and having a nominal thickness; at least one localized, protuberance extending from the wall; and
a cooling hole extending through the protuberance and the wall, having a length greater than the nominal thickness of the wall.
19 . The airfoil of claim 18 wherein the first side is an interior surface of the airfoil and the protuberance is disposed on the first side.
